所以要想获得准确的查询参数,使用 Page 的 searchParams prop 或是在客户端组件中使用 useSearchParams hook 它们会在客户端重新渲染的时候带上最新的 searchParams。 可以使用 useRouter 或者 Link 设置新的searchParams。当路由变化后,当前的 page.js 会收到一个更新的searchParamsprop: // app/example-client-co...
新建一个 JS 内置的 URL 对象,其中的 searchParams 就是URL 里的请求参数。 export async function GET(request: Request) { const {searchParams} = new URL(request.url); const sessionId = searchParams.get('session_id') const securityKey = searchParams.get('security_key') } 参考: stackoverflow...
Search results 29 packages found 1 2 Sort Packages Optimal Popularity Quality Maintenance nextjs-toploader A Next.js Top Loading Bar component made using nprogress, works with Next.js 14 and React. Next Next TopLoader Next.js Next.js 14 Next.js 13 Nprogress React Top Loading Bar Progressbar...
Next.js 是一套 React 体系的 SSR (服务端渲染)方案,现在很多前端网站实际上是 SPA (单页应用),就只有一个 index.html ,然后附带一个很大的 js 来实现页面渲染和交互,这种小规模的网站还好,网站越大速度就越慢,所以说技术这个车轮又滚回去了,当初被「前后端分离」那帮人嫌弃的后端渲染又回来了,React 有 ne...
Next.js,是第二个让我由心觉得好用,觉得「我艹,可以啊」的一个框架。第一个是在2015年的时候,接触到的Angular 1.x. 我们公司,在去年11月,开始对前端重构优化,将公司的主要页面由 egg.js + requireJS + jQuery 切换至 Next.js,由我来owner,最多时投入9个前端人力,日常4个,立项时排期3个月,实际历时5...
Next.js에서는 환경 변수 이름이 NEXT_PUBLIC_으로 시작해야 클라이언트 사이드에서도 환경 변수에 접근할 수 있다 배포 시 웹서버에서 발생하는 문제 : 배포할 때 프로젝트 설정에 env...
Next.js 13,它带来了全新的理念(server component),作为一名 Next.js 的爱好者,我们有必要重新学习和认识下它。 Turbopack 首先是最引入注目的,在 Next13 中加入了全新的打包工具 Turbopack, 它是出自 Webpack 作者 TobiasKoppers 之手,官方描述是:开发时更新速度比 Webpack 快 700 倍、比 Vite 快 10 倍,...
Next.js react toolbar overrides vercel-release-bot •2.6.3•2 months ago•6dependents•MITpublished version2.6.3,2 months ago6dependentslicensed under $MIT 1,123,295 state-in-url Store state in URL as in object, types and structure are preserved, with TS validation. Same API as Re...
博客的 UI 框架部分使用了 antd,在页面加载的过程中会有一个骨架屏,不过因为 antd5 的版本使用 style 来重构样式,在组件运行的时候注入方便定制和切换主题,导致 Next.js 使用的时候资源不会被缓存且导致骨架屏最初样式没有被加载出来。 目前issues 有相关讨论,但是还没解决。 解决方法: ...
最近在学React.js,React官方推荐使用next.js框架作为构建服务端渲染的网站,所以今天来研究一下next.js的使用。 next.js作为一款轻量级的应用框架,主要用于构建静态网站和后端渲染网站。 框架特点 使用后端渲染 自动进行代码分割(code splitting),以获得更快的网页加载速度 ...